As we approach the launch of the Swiss Subnet, several new node providers have the opportunity to join ICP with Gen-2 nodes!
As outlined in our Proposal to Commence the Swiss Subnet with 13 Nodes in Switzerland and Liechtenstein, we will launch with 13 nodes spread geographically across 10 Swiss cantons and 3 in Liechtenstein.
Swiss companies interested in participating in ICP and the Swiss Subnet as a node provider should submit their applications now. Contact us at team@subnet.ch or here on the forum for more information if you think you meet our requirements.
- The prospective node provider (NP) must be a Swiss-domiciled and Swiss-owned company (or is a Swiss foundation, university or government body). The NP must be independent from all other node providers (i.e. there can be no shared ownership, technicians, or material financing)
- The NP must have a data center provider in a suitable canton (only one NP per canton). Liechtenstein and the cantons AR, BE, GE, TI, VD, VS, ZG and ZH are already covered. However, feel free to get in touch anyway, as we may need more nodes soon.
- The NP must purchase a Gen-2 server from Swiss Subnet AG; delivery will begin in mid-July.
- The NP must also accept and satisfy all ICP requirements for node providers in general, e.g. Node Provider Roadmap - Internet Computer Wiki
Please note that, although while we are pre-selecting node providers to satisfy the Swiss Subnet NP requirements, all NPs and data centers will ultimately undergo the standard NNS process before their nodes are selected to create the Swiss Subnet.
